A tight reach extension wrench is a specialized tool designed to access and loosen or tighten nuts and bolts in confined or hard-to-reach spaces. It features a flexible shaft that allows it to bend and maneuver around obstacles, making it ideal for tasks in tight engine compartments, behind dashboards, and other areas with limited accessibility.
The wrench's extension and flexibility provide several benefits:
- Extended reach: It allows mechanics and DIY enthusiasts to reach fasteners that are otherwise inaccessible with standard wrenches.
- Maneuverability: The flexible shaft enables the wrench to navigate around obstructions and reach awkward angles, making it suitable for complex repairs.
- Compact design: Tight reach extension wrenches are often compact and lightweight, making them easy to handle in confined spaces.
Tight reach extension wrenches have become essential tools in various industries, including automotive repair, plumbing, and electrical work. Their ability to access hard-to-reach areas and provide additional leverage makes them indispensable for completing tasks efficiently and effectively.

Durability
Tight reach extension wrenches are designed and constructed to withstand the demands of various tasks, ensuring longevity and reliability in challenging work environments.
- Robust Construction: These wrenches are typically made from durable materials such as chrome vanadium steel, which provides strength and resistance to wear and tear.
- Heat Treatment: Many tight reach extension wrenches undergo heat treatment processes to enhance their strength and durability, making them capable of handling high-torque applications.
- Corrosion Resistance: Some wrenches are coated or treated to resist corrosion, ensuring longevity even in harsh or wet environments.
- Ergonomic Design: The ergonomic design of these wrenches reduces fatigue during prolonged use, contributing to overall durability by preventing strain on the user's hands and arms.
The durability of tight reach extension wrenches ensures that they can withstand the rigors of professional and DIY use, providing reliable performance and longevity in demanding applications.

Tips for Using Tight Reach Extension Wrenches Effectively
Tight reach extension wrenches are highly versatile tools, but using them correctly is vital for optimal performance and safety. Here are some essential tips to maximize their effectiveness:
Choose the Right Wrench: Select a wrench with a flexible shaft of appropriate length and a head size that fits the fastener securely. Avoid using wrenches with excessively long or short shafts, as they may hinder maneuverability or compromise precision.
Secure the Fastener: Before applying force, ensure the fastener is properly seated in the wrench head to prevent slippage. This helps transmit torque effectively and reduces the risk of damaging the fastener or wrench.
Use Smooth, Controlled Motions: Apply force gradually and avoid sudden or excessive movements. Jerking or overtightening can damage the fastener or wrench. Instead, use smooth, controlled motions to achieve the desired tightness.
Access Awkward Angles: Tight reach extension wrenches excel in accessing awkward angles. Bend the shaft as needed to reach fasteners in confined spaces or around obstacles. Use a combination of the flexible shaft and the wrench's head articulation for maximum maneuverability.
Prevent Obstruction: Be aware of your surroundings and ensure there are no obstructions that could hinder the wrench's movement. Clear away any obstacles or use a different tool if the wrench cannot reach the fastener without interference.
Maintain the Wrench: Keep your tight reach extension wrench clean and well-maintained. Regularly inspect the shaft for any signs of damage or wear. Lubricate the moving parts periodically to ensure smooth operation and extend the wrench's lifespan.
By following these tips, you can use tight reach extension wrenches effectively and safely, maximizing their functionality and extending their service life.
